I bought a new cartridge for my dad’s printed at hometown. After few weeks, there’s nothing printed. I suspected that the print head is now clogged.

Today, I’m going to share how to de-clogging a clogged printer cartridge. Please note that this sharing is applicable to inkjet printer with print head attached to the cartridge.

Basically this technique has been shared by a seller from a printer shop that I visited recently.

Steps:

  1. Boil maybe a cup/glass of water.
  2. Soak the printer head in the boiled water for a few minutes.
  3. Wipe it clean
  4. Put back the cartridge into the printer.
  5. Have a test print. If the print result still no 100% OK, you may use the printer tools available on your computer to tune it.

** above tested/done on HP 678 cartridge.
